PLN 2014-1520, TREE REMOVAL PERMIT FOR 6455 EL CAMINO REAL Property Owner/Applicant: Gary Englund, 6455 El Camino Real, Atascadero, CA 93422 Brian Englund, 6455 El Camino Real, Atascadero, CA 93422 Certified Arborist: Michael Bova, Davey Resource Group, 2318 20th Street, Bakersfield, CA 93301 Project Title: PLN 2014-1520/TRP 2014-0176 Tree Removal Permit for 6455 El Camino Real (Sylvester’s Burgers) Project Location: 6455 El Camino Real, Atascadero CA 93422 (San Luis Obispo County) APN 029-344-033 Project Description: A request to remove one (1) 64-inch DBH Live Oak tree located near the corner of West Mall and El Camino Real in the downtown. The tree was evaluated by the City’s consulting arborist and was given a risk rating of High to Severe Risk based on previous large limb failure and high target value. The property owner has submitted a tree removal application to remove the hazardous tree located on the property frontage. The removal would be subject to mitigation, which is proposed as replanting in the same location with one new 24-inch box size tree. General Plan Designation: Downtown (D) Zoning District: Downtown Commercial (DC) Staff Recommendation: Staff recommends that the Planning Commission approve the removal of one (1) 64-inch Live Oak tree, subject to conditions of approval, including replanting one (1) new Live Oak tree on the property frontage. TO SPEAK ON AGENDA ITEMS (from Title 2, Chapter 1 of the Atascadero Municipal Code) Members of the audience may speak on any item on the agenda. The Chairperson will identify the subject, staff will give their report, and the Commission will ask questions of staff. The Chairperson will announce when the public comment period is open and will request anyone interested to address the Commission regarding the matter being considered to step up to the lectern. If you wish to speak for, against or comment in any way: 1. You must approach the lectern and be recognized by the Chairperson. 2. Give your name (not required). 3. Make your statement. 4. All comments should be made to the Chairperson and Commission. 5. No person shall be permitted to make slanderous, profane or negative personal remarks concerning any other individual, absent or present. 6. All comments limited to 3 minutes. If you wish to use a computer presentation to support your comments, you must notify the C ommunity Development Department at 470-3402 at least 24 hours prior to the meeting. Digital presentations brought to the meeting should be on a USB drive or CD. You are required to submit to the Recording Secretary a printed copy of your presentation for the record. Please check in with the Recording Secretary before the meeting begins to announce your presence and turn in the printed copy. The Chairperson will announce when the public comment period is closed, and thereafter, no further public comments will be heard by the Commission.
